§ 54:5-21 — Lands listed for sale; liens listed; installments added.
New Jersey·Title 54 TAXATION
54:5-21. The collector shall make a list of the lands so subject to sale, describing them in accordance with the last tax duplicate, including the name of the owner as shown on the duplicate, amplifying the description in the duplicate if necessary to better identify the parcel. He shall enter on the list all taxes, assessments and other municipal charges which were a lien at the close of the fiscal year. He shall add to the list all unpaid installments of assessments for benefits theretofore levied and existing as immediate or direct benefits, whether then payable or not, so that the list shall be a complete statement of all municipal charges against the property existing at the close of the fiscal year, together with all interest and costs on all of the items of the list computed to date
